Highlighted by Billboard for his standout sunrise set at Burning Man in 2018, N2N is an accomplished DJ and producer who seamlessly blends styles on labels like Sony, hau5trap, and Glasgow Underground, to name a few. The Brooklyn-based artist links up with producer and mixing engineer Rob Marion for South Of Saturn’s landmark one-hundredth release, ‘Losing My Shit’.
Together they cook up the intoxicating ‘Losing My Shit’. It’s a party-pumping house sound that sees bumping basslines collide with well-swung drums and laser-like synths as a sultry but sensuous vocal drips with attitude.
N2N & Rob Marion ‘Losing My Shit’ is out now via South of Saturn – buy HERE.
